I draw TF2 comics sometimes. My trick was to first draw all the classes from the computer screen (there used to be good pictures of them in their 'standard' pose on tfportal.de - not any more), then draw individual posed pictures using my sketches as reference. It makes it a lot easier than trying to draw poses from memory or a screenshot.
